# Basement Archive Room — Night Access

The archive room under Pellworth House holds old contracts and the tape backups. Night shift: take stairwell C, not the lift (it's switched off after midnight). Lights are on a timer by the door — slap the button as you go in. Sign the logbook, even at 3am, yes really. The keypad by the door takes the code below.

staff pass of fahap-tajeg = bdg-FT-6

### Runbook: Proctorline queue stalls

If exam sessions pile up in the Proctorline review queue, it's almost always the queue worker losing its connection to the broker. First, restart the worker pod — that clears it nine times out of ten. If it keeps crash-looping, check the env file on the worker host; a bad or missing broker credential is the usual culprit. The entry you need to verify sits at the bottom of the file, right after this comment:

sealed setting: ARCHIVE_KEY3=8d0

- [ ] Verify the Larkmoor Clinic appointment reminder job completes a full dry run against the staging roster before cutover. Confirm quiet-hours suppression holds for the Westhollow timezone group and that duplicate reminders are deduped by visit slot, not patient record. The trace token from the passing dry run goes directly below this item.

build token for kagaf-hahof: htk14_9d3d4d26d7d8de